Proper documentation is essential when working with survivors of domestic violence. This two day training assists advocates by providing a greater understanding of using trauma-informed principles in documentation. You will learn to identify the risks of documenting too little, too much and risks unique to custody cases. Topics include confidentiality provisions in VOCA, VAWA and FVPSA, and ways to create better documentation of survivors. Best practice relating to subpoenas and warrants and who can file Motions to Quash and when they can be filed will be discussed. You'll also learn about trauma vs. mental health and strategies for advocacy.
